Can Clogged Gutters Cause Roof & Ceiling Leaks?

Your gutters are the primary way to collect rainwater from your roof and divert the flow away from your home. When gutters are clogged with leaves and debris, the rainwater doesn’t drain and remains stagnant on the roof causing leaks and other structural damage to your home. Roof and ceiling leaks from clogged gutters can even lead to mold growth or pest infestation, so it’s important for the health of your family that you address these issues promptly.

What You Need To Know About Insurance And Roof Replacement

What You Need To Know About Insurance And Roof Replacement

Your typical homeowner’s insurance policy will cover your roof replacement if it gets damaged by a covered peril, like sudden accidents or acts of nature. Problems from regular wear and tear, old age, or lack of maintenance are not eligible for reimbursement. Such damages are often categorized under the general maintenance responsibility of the homeowner. (more…)
